London
London
London
London
London
London
London
London
London
London
London
London
London
London
Thornton Heath
SW9
London
London
Ilford
Ilford
London
London
London
London
London
London
London
London
London
London
London
London
London
London
Portsoken
London
London
London
Woodford Green
Woodford Green